Guwahati, May 15:The top brass of the National People’s Party met with the party’s state hierarchies in a Guwahati hotel on May 14 last to discuss the strategies that are to be adopted in Arunachal Pradesh after the election result is declared on May 23.
According to a press release issued today by the state NPP, the coordination meeting was presided by the Chief Minister of Meghalaya cum National President Conrad K Sangma and attended by State President Gicho Kabak and the candidates who represented NPP in the state assembly election. Deputy Chief Minister of Manipur Joy Kumar Singh, Home Minister of Meghalaya James Sangma and other party leaders were also present in the meeting.
State President Gicho Kabak highlighted the number of assembly seats NPP expects to win in Arunachal Pradesh  and suggested for the selection of the legislature party leader soon after election result after due consultation with the elected MLAs and the National President. MLA candidates including former Home Minister Kumar Waii, Mutchu Mithi, Tirong Aboh, Nikh Kamin, enumerated the difficulties they faced during the election campaign in their respective assembly constituencies and suggested for strengthening of party organization in the state.
The party’s National President Conrad K Sangma appreciated the contesting MLA candidates for putting up a strong fight and expressed hope for a landmark victory in Arunachal. Sangma directed the State President to re-organize and strength the party’s base immediately  in all districts and in various ranks such as state office-bearer, frontal heads etc and assured his full support and cooperation regarding this.
Chief Minister of Manipur Joykumar Singh who is also the National Vice-President of NPP while advising the contested candidates not to leave party after election result, also  assured his full support for strengthening the party organization in the state.
It is the new look worth mentioning that NPP has put up one MP candidate in 1-Arunachal Western Parliamentary Constituency and thirty MLA candidates in the Assembly Election 2019 in Arunachal Pradesh. NPP-BJP has coalition governments in the northeastern region under North East Democratic Alliance (NEDA) & National Democratic Alliance (NDA). NPP Press Release
